Unlocking more speed and distance through multi-material technology and proven innovations like Carbonfly Wrap, Ti-Facewrap and Spinsistency, PING introduced the G430 LST 3-wood today.
The low-spinning, tour-style design combines a 2041 Beta-Ti face, Ti 8-1-1 body, and 80-gram tungsten sole plate to position the CG low/back for faster ball speeds with reduced spin, producing on average seven yards more distance.
The variable-thickness, high-strength titanium face wraps into the crown and sole of the lightweight titanium body, generating more flexing for faster ball speed and higher launch for greater distance. The combination of the titanium body and high-density 80-gram tungsten sole plate helps position the CG lower and farther back to produce higher-launching, lower-spinning and longer shots.
The low-profile, 169cc head also benefits from Spinsistency, a proven clubface innovation engineered with a variable roll radius that improves performance across the face (especially on shots hit low on the face) by reducing spin for more distance. A tighter bulge radius increases ball speed and minimizes off-line dispersion.
The LST (Low Spin Technology) model joins the MAX and SFT (Straight Flight Technology) designs in completing the line of G430 fairway woods introduced earlier this year. Like those models, the LST 3-wood is engineered with a Carbonfly Wrap crown to help deliver more distance by positioning the CG lower and closer to the force line to maximize ball speed, resulting in higher, longer carries. The 8-layer composite crown, which saves approximately 5.5 grams compared to a titanium crown, wraps into the heel and toe sections of the skirt. The discretionary weight is reallocated to achieve the lower CG and increase ball speed. The composite crown weighs 8.5 grams fully installed and contributes to the club’s pleasing sound.
